Bullets, Bombs, and Fast Talk: Twenty-five Years of FBI War Stories James Botting
Bullets, Bombs, and Fast Talk: Twenty-five Years of FBI War Stories
James Botting
A desperate gunman holds a planeload of innocent passengers hostage. A heavily armed cult leader refuses to leave his compound, threatening mass suicide by a hundred of his brainwashed followers. A neo-Nazi militant in a cabin hideout keeps federal agents at bay with gunfire.
